Secure Cloud Backup
Backup data to Day One Sync from one device for free.
Users with the Basic account status can back up unlimited data from one device. This service requires signing into a Day One account in the Settings. Once signed in, data is backed up securely to Day One Sync while the app is opened.
- Create a Day One account
- Sign into Day One Sync
- Verify the encryption key is saved by going to Settings > Sync > Encryption Key
When starting Day One for the first time, users will be prompted to sign in to enable secure cloud backup.

Users can verify synced data anytime by signing into https://dayone.me in a web browser.
When changing from an old phone, iPad, computer, or tablet to a new one, please follow these instructions to uninstall and install the Day One app from the old to the new device:
- Verify that data is synced by signing into the web app at https://dayone.me/ in a web browser
- Compare the entry/media counts under “All Entries” with what is on the old device.
- Once you are sure everything matches, sign into Day One on the new device to switch it to the Active device
- As a Basic user, you will be prompted with a message to subscribe to Day One Premium or to Move your journal
- Tap the Move your journal button to access your previous journal(s), as shown in the screenshot below
Switching the Active device may be done once every 30 days. Or, unlock Sync on all devices by subscribing to Premium. If you need assistance managing the devices you’re using with Day One Sync, please reach out to support. We can add and remove devices that have been connected to your account.
